
Beechgrove Coniston is a fully refurbished four-bedroom cottage in the heart of Coniston village, Lake District. This property sleeps eight people across four well-appointed bedrooms. Perfect for group gatherings with its bright open-plan kitchen, dining and lounge area. French doors open onto a large patio with BBQ facilities. The enclosed garden provides a safe space for children and dogs to play.
The village location puts local pubs, cafes and shops within easy walking distance. Rolling hills and Coniston Water create a stunning backdrop. The area offers excellent access to hiking trails and water sports.
Accommodation includes one king-size bedroom with zip-and-link option, one twin room and a master bedroom with en-suite shower room and Smart TV.

Three bathrooms serve the property: two shower rooms and one en-suite. The fully equipped kitchen features a double oven, induction hob, American fridge freezer with ice maker and dishwasher. A utility room houses a washing machine, tumble dryer and dog shower for muddy paws.
The Old Man of Coniston mountain (1.2 miles, 5 minutes) offers challenging walks. Coniston Water (0.8 miles, 3 minutes) provides water sports opportunities. Brantwood House (2.1 miles, 6 minutes) showcases John Ruskin's former home. Grizedale Forest (5.4 miles, 12 minutes) features mountain biking trails and Go Ape activities.
Beechgrove Coniston combines village convenience with outdoor adventure access. Groups seeking Lake District exploration will appreciate the enclosed garden, ample parking and dog-friendly facilities.

To reach Beechgrove Coniston by car, take the A593 into Coniston village. The cottage is located in the village centre with convenient on-site parking for two to three cars and electric vehicle charging facilities.
For those travelling by rail, the nearest station is Windermere, approximately 13 miles away. From there, take a taxi or local bus service to Coniston village for your Lake District break.
